1

Allergy Research Buffered Vitamin C Capsules, 120Caps

Allergy Research Buffered Vitamin C Capsules, 120caps

Allergy Research Buffered Vitamin C Capsules, 120caps: Allergy Research Buffered Vitamin C Capsules contains high-purity ascorbic acid buffered with carbonates of calcium and...


1


  • News Mentions